This study evaluates the safety of the drug Elacestrant in patients with ER-positive/HER2-negative, ESR1-mutated metastatic breast cancer. Postmenopausal women aged 18 and older whose disease has progressed after at least one line of hormone therapy can take part. It is a study without an assigned phase and is still enrolling participants.

Inclusion Criteria: * 1\. must have a histologically or cytologically confirmed diagnosis of breast cancer with evidence of locally advanced disease unsuitable for excision or radical radiotherapy, or evidence of metastatic disease unsuitable for radical treatment. * 2\. female ≥ 18 years of age * 3\. female subjects must be postmenopausal (meeting any of the following criteria is sufficient) a) Has undergone oophorectomy. b) Age ≥ 60 years. c) 40 years old \< age ≤ 60 years old with 1 year of menopause. d) Age \<60 years and receiving ovarian suppression therapy. * 4\. ER-positive and HER2-negative status and ESR1-mutation positive must be confirmed. * 5\. must have progressed on at least one line of endocrine therapy prior to enrollment, including monotherapy or combination therapy. * 6\. have normal organ function (as assessed by the investigator). Exclusion Criteria: * 1\. women who are pregnant or breastfeeding * 2\. known difficulties in tolerating oral medications, or conditions that interfere with the absorption of oral medications or allergies to medications and their excitements * 3\. other conditions that make enrollment in the study unsuitable, at the discretion of the investigator
